一个 SQL 实例是否可以正常工作,而其他 2 个已打补丁?

jac*_*ack 5 sql-server patching

由于一个实例,我在同一台服务器上修补 3 个 SQL 实例的更改请求被拒绝了 - 他们说服务器重启没问题,但不是几个小时的停机时间。

既然每个实例都是独立的,那么修补 2 个实例并保留第三个实例不是很好吗?

我看到有一个“共享组件”功能 - 这到底是什么,在修补过程中所有实例都关闭了,这有关系吗?

我怎样才能减轻我的同事对第三个实例仍然有效的恐惧——企业不愿意让它在晚上停机几个小时。

Dav*_*ett 3

如果每个实例和使用它的应用程序仅依赖于数据库引擎,那么升级每个实例根本不会影响其他实例,除非需要重新启动(并且通常对于 SQL 补丁或服务包,仅重新启动相关 SQL需要服务,而不是完全重新启动机器)。

有关功能列表,请参阅https://learn.microsoft.com/en-us/sql/sql-server/install/feature-selection 。大多数共享组件是应用程序或客户端层部分,因此即使应用程序正在使用它们,它们也可能不会在此服务器上使用它们(而是将它们安装在其他地方并使用它们连接到服务器上的实例)。